MANHATTAN (KSNT) – On Friday, the City of Manhattan announced the winners of its snowplow naming competition for the 2025-2026 winter weather season.

According to the city, participants submitted over 400 names and cast over 900 votes. The naming competition included: 15 Public Works Department snow plows, four Parks and Rec snow plows, two fire department snow plows and one large snow removal vehicle for the Manhattan Regional Airport.
